Denver Beer Company


      What a wonderful day for a beer.  As we sat outside the one of Denver's new breweries we were surrounded by a large assortment of people and of dogs.   Everything from little "yippy" dogs to large drooling St Bernard's.  There had been a pretty consistent wind all day but that was far from affecting Denver Beer Co, they were still packed inside and out.  Sure enough, the beer spoke for the crowd,  there was everything from Hefeweizen to a Graham Cracker Porter and all the beers were wonderful.  My favorite was the Hefewiezen it had an amazing balance of clove and banana flavors with a slight overall background fruitiness that gave this beer a "bubblegum",  yes bubblegum type flavor.  I know that may sound like an unusual flavor but it did an amazing job in complementing the beers style.
      Not only does this brewery make great beer but it has only ever repeated a few of its recipes so you are almost always guaranteed to find something new on tap that has never been released before and might never be released again.  I wholeheartedly agree with this philosophy and think that it is a great way to keep things new and interesting.  Denver Beer Co also (as many small breweries do now) have weekly concerts, food carts, and many other awesome events.  For instance coming up the brewery will be supporting a Denver Bike Day by having bikers who stop by the brewery actually grind the grain for their brew using a bike powered mill!  Super awesome... Anyway, this brewery was fun, upbeat, and wholly delicious.
